Finance Review Summary — Lintmere Holdings

For branch managers: current analysis shows the Quarrowden account represents 38% of receivables, a level the finance committee considers an unacceptable concentration risk. Payment terms remain on schedule, but exposure warrants caution in forward planning. Branches should prioritise pipeline breadth over single large wins. The agreed confidential response is recorded immediately below.

board note of bawep-tajef: Queniusek Systems plans to raise the Quenvan list price by 53.1 percent in March. The pricing group signed off on a budget of $176.4 million for Project Drueth. The renewal with Casionix Partners closes at $142.5 million a year, 8.3 percent below the last contract. Project Fraax slips by six weeks because of the tooling delay.

FINANCE REVIEW — Heads of Department

The Bramwick Stores pilot closed its first quarter within 3% of forecast. Margin on the Corvale fixture line held at 41%; returns negligible. Rollout costs ran high in the Eastport cluster due to install delays, now resolved. Bramwick signals interest in expanding to 60 sites. Finance recommends proceeding, contingent on renegotiated freight terms. Keep figures internal until the contract amendment is signed. Context for the next phase appears directly below.

management briefing: Jorixax Holdings is in early talks to buy Casixax Holdings for about $420.3 million. The Fenmir launch date is October 27, and nothing goes to the press before then. Legal wants the Keloxek Foods term sheet redrafted before April 16.

Leadership Review Briefing — Pindrow Systems
Audience: Sales Leads

Next year's training budget: held flat overall. Reallocation favours the Corvail product certification track; legacy Ostrim courses cut by half. External venues dropped; sessions move to the Maren Hall site. No exceptions without VP sign-off. Expect final allocations at the review itself. The linked commercial rationale appears in the confidential note below.

management briefing: The renewal with Quenathox Group closes at $10 million a year, 20 percent below the last contract. Project Ulawyn slips by two quarters because of the supplier delay.

**Onboarding — Merrittvale Partner SFTP Drop** Quick heads-up for your first week: our partner file feeds land on the Merrittvale SFTP drop nightly, and the fetcher script pulls them into the staging bucket around 02:00. The fetcher won't start without its SFTP credential, which we don't commit anywhere — you add it to your local env file yourself. Pop this line into your env file:

env line for fafof-fahag: LEDGER_TOKEN5=f8790